My yard floods and then cracks. What's the solution for this clay?

This is the classic shrink-swell hazard of Blackland Prairie Clay, which expands when wet and contracts when dry, breaking foundations and drowning roots. The solution involves regrading to create positive drainage away from structures and installing French drains. Using permeable crushed Austin limestone for patios or paths increases infiltration, helping projects meet City of Uhland Planning & Zoning runoff standards.

What are the biggest weed threats and how do I deal with them safely?

In Uhland, watch for invasive Bermuda grass (Cynodon dactylon) and nutsedges, which thrive in compacted clay. Treatment requires targeted post-emergent herbicides applied during active growth phases, strictly avoiding phosphorus-based products to comply with regional stormwater rules. For long-term control, improving soil health through aeration and proper fertilization outcompetes these invaders.

How can I keep my Zeon Zoysia green under the 2-day-a-week watering rules?

Stage 2 restrictions make ET-based smart controllers essential. These Wi-Fi systems calculate daily evapotranspiration, applying water only when the lawn needs it, which is often less than the allotted days. For TifTuf Bermuda or Zeon Zoysia, this means programming deep, infrequent cycles that encourage drought-tolerant roots while staying compliant, effectively preserving turf health within the municipal water budget.

My soil is hard as a rock and nothing grows well. Why is my Uhland yard like this?

Properties built around 1999 in Uhland City Center are on the original Blackland Prairie Clay subsoil, compacted during construction. With 27 years of settling, this soil has matured into a dense layer with high pH (7.9-8.2) and very poor permeability. It requires systematic soil fracturing through deep-core aeration and the incorporation of composted organic matter to improve structure and microbial activity for healthy plant roots.
